Spalding fell victim to LaGrange and their airtight pitching crew on Wednesday. They lost 8-0 to the LaGrange Grangers. The match marked the first time this year in which the Jaguars were not able to get on the board.
Spalding saw three different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Cara Webb, who went 1-for-3 with a double.
Spalding has been struggling recently as they've lost four of their last five contests, which put a noticeable dent in their 12-8 record this season. As for LaGrange, the victory (which was their third in a row) raised their record to 12-6.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Spalding will host Crawford County at 5:30 p.m. on Monday. As for LaGrange, they will play host again on Saturday to welcome Cedartown, where first pitch is scheduled at 9:30 a.m.
